Welcome to KASHIWAGI CAFE, a delightful and cozy escape nestled in the heart of Shinjuku, Tokyo. Located just a stone's throw away from major office buildings, this charming café invites you to unwind and indulge in a sensory experience that perfectly marries the joys of coffee with a unique touch of whimsy.

KASHIWAGI CAFE stands out not just for its inviting ambiance but also for its captivating miniature train set that winds through the café, enchanting customers of all ages. Imagine sipping on a refreshing iced coffee or a tropical mango juice while watching tiny trains navigate their tracks—a playful yet tranquil backdrop for your moments of relaxation.

Cozy cafe around the corner from major office building. Cute train set to play with. A bit pricey but not too bad. Happy hour is the best time to visit. Special events are a rip off but you don't have to join them .

Between building cafe where there is a railway miniature place. Always stop by for a light drink and chilling out. Got terrace seats which can bring pet. Only 3 minutes walk from Nishi Shinjuku Metro Subway Station.

Good lunch sets and portions. One star knock for it being a smoking establishment out on terrace but door to inside the cafe still open so could smell the smoke. We are in a pandemic smoking doesn't help that.
